Hegi Castle

A visit to Hegi Castle in the east of Winterthur is not only worthwhile because of the ancient building, which dates back to the 13th century. The complex, which now houses a museum and serves as a venue for cultural events, has 1.6-metre-thick walls and is visible from afar thanks to its 10-metre-high tower. Just as exciting, however, is the spacious vegetable garden on the east side of the castle, which was planted in 2012. Vegetables from days long gone are grown in the garden. You can even enjoy them in the "Schloss Schenke" at the weekend.
